FLEX OSR Event Manager

Remote Full-time
Marriott International is the world’s largest hotel company, and they are seeking a FLEX OSR Event Manager to oversee the coordination of property events. The role involves preparing event documentation, collaborating with various departments to ensure exceptional service, and maximizing revenue opportunities through upselling.ResponsibilitiesResponsible for preparing all event documentation and coordinates with Sales, property departments and customer to ensure consistent, high level service throughout pre-event, event and post-event phases of property eventsEnsures their property events have a seamless turnover from sales to service back to salesRecognizes opportunities to maximize revenue opportunities by up-selling and offering enhancements to create outstanding eventsEnsures that events progress seamlessly by following established procedures, collaborating with other employees, and ensuring accuracyGreets customer during the event phase and hands-off to the Event Operations team for the execution of detailsAdheres to all standards, policies, and proceduresEnsures billing accuracy and conducts bill reviews with the clients prior to processing the final billManages group room blocks and meeting space for average to large-sized assigned groupsIdentifies operational challenges associated with his/her group and determines how to best work with the property staff and customer to solve these challenges and/or develop alternative solutionsUses his/her judgment to integrate current trends in event management and event designActs as liaison between field salesperson and customer throughout the event process (pre-event, event, post-event)Participates in customer site inspections and assists with the sales process as necessaryPerforms other duties as assigned to meet business needsSolicits feedback from the property departments to identify areas for improvement to enhance the Event Planner’s experienceDelivers excellent customer service throughout the customer experience and encourages the same from other employeesEmpowers employees to provide excellent customer serviceSets a positive example for guest relationsCoordinates and communicates event details both verbally and in writing to the customer and property operationsMakes presence known to customer at all times during this processOversees his/her customer experiences from file turnover through the post event phase until turnover back to salesFollows up with customer post-eventResponds to and handles guest problems and complaintsUses personal judgment and expertise to enhance the customer experienceStays available to solve problems and/or suggest alternatives to previous arrangementsWorks to continually improve customer service by integrating obtained feedback and personal judgment into action plansEmphasizes guest satisfaction during all departmental meetings and focuses on continuous improvementInteracts with guests to obtain feedback on product quality and service levelsEnsures hourly employees understand expectations and parameters for event activitiesConducts formal pre- and post-event meetings as required to review/communicate group needs and feedbackLeads formal pre-event and post-event meetings for average to large-sized assigned groupsFacilitates various meetings as he/she perceives necessary (Banquet Event Order meeting, block review, etc)Assists in the sales process and revenue forecasting for customer groupsUp-sells products and services throughout the event processForecasts group sleeping rooms and event revenue (catering and audio visual) for his/her groupsReviews comment cards and guest satisfaction results with employeesObserves service behaviors of employees and provides feedback to individuals and/or managersAssists in the development and implementation of corrective action plansTake initiative to use his/her experience to improve service performance according to his/her evaluation of the issue and resolutionWorks with the property staff and customers to address operational challenges associated with his/her groupPerforms other duties as assigned to meet business needsSkillsHigh school diploma or GED; experienced (1 – 2 years of experience) in the event management or related professional area2-year degree from an accredited university in Hotel and Restaurant Management, Hospitality, Business Administration, or related major; at least 1 year experience in the event management or related professional area requiredBenefits401(k) planStock purchase planDiscounts at Marriott propertiesCommuter benefitsEmployee assistance planChildcare discountsCoverage for medicalDentalVisionHealth care flexible spending accountDependent care flexible spending accountLife insuranceDisability insuranceAccident insuranceAdoption expense reimbursementsPaid parental leaveEmployees will accrue paid sick leave0.0384 PTO balance for every hour workedMinimum of 9 holidays annuallyCompany OverviewMarriott International, Inc.
